WAYNE BLOY

Bantamweight Wayne was born in Grimsby on November 30, 1982, and is managed by former Midland Area light-heavyweight champion Stuart Fleet.
He fought as an amateur but it became increasingly difficult to find suitable opponents.
Wayne made his professional debut on June 2004 at the Winter Gardens, Cleethorpes, and went on an unbeaten run until October 2006 when he was outpointed by Jamie McDonnell.
He later faced the same opponent for the English Championship in Doncaster in February 2007 but was stopped in the third round.
Before traditional boxing, Wayne was a top kick-boxer and took the WUMA European title in December 2003.
He is a former member of the Grimsby Kickboxing Club’s Strike Team under coach Dale Lowe, himself a former boxing pro.
